Chemical Property Profile of N-(5-cyclohexyl-1,3,4-thiadiazol-2-yl)-3-phenylbutanamide
Property Insights of N-(5-cyclohexyl-1,3,4-thiadiazol-2-yl)-3-phenylbutanamide
The XLogP value of 4.7181 indicates that N-(5-cyclohexyl-1,3,4-thiadiazol-2-yl)-3-phenylbutanamide is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 54.88 Ų, N-(5-cyclohexyl-1,3,4-thiadiazol-2-yl)-3-phenylbutanamide ex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, N-(5-cyclohexyl-1,3,4-thiadiazol-2-yl)-3-phenylbutanamide has 1 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
